This is a very classy, upscale type place that I had very high hopes for, but unfortunately I cant give more than an average rating.
Here's what I liked:
- The ambience
- The wait staff - very attentive and friendly
- Grilled Flounder was cooked and seasoned perfectly
- The accompanying Aioli with the Trout was fantastic
- The Meatloaf was unique tasting with a nice crispy crust and tasty center
- Cornbread appetizer was very large and was pretty good
- Homemade Creamy Garlic salad dressing was outstanding!
Here's what I didn't like:
- Appetizers were few (need more variety and offerings)
- Double Dip appetizer - Pimento Cheese was not mixed thoroughly as every bite seemed different - either overly flavorful or just bland!
- Tortilla Chips just didn't seem a good pairing with the Pimento Cheese. Chips were good with Guacamole, but think a pita chip or some type cracker would of been better.
- In the side salad the red cabbage was so bitter that it over powered every bite I took and made the salad almost inedible - dressing was great
- I ordered Trout and it just came out on the plate, with no side or anything accompanying it. When I asked, the waitress was like oh yeah, it should come with rice or broccoli. Shouldn't someone of noticed just a piece of fish alone on the plate before it was sent out?
- The person that ordered Meatloaf asked for Fries (not mashed potatoes) and his plate arrived with the Mashed. Informed waitress and he eventually got a side order of fries.
++ that's 2 orders out of 4 that came out wrong! At a restaurant like this that shouldn't happen.
Yes I would go back at some point, but there are many places I want to try before I give them another chance.
